Output e704cb361cde51bfe3e129ade31a838c8552fa8a25ad3e84ec81c7ec92970fe6:0

value
657077
script pubkey
OP_0 OP_PUSHBYTES_20 daf5bba0070a651049fc70a9cd0db95a85d1c168
address
bc1qmt6mhgq8pfj3qj0uwz5u6rdet2zarstglz40ru
transaction
e704cb361cde51bfe3e129ade31a838c8552fa8a25ad3e84ec81c7ec92970fe6
confirmations
226176
spent
true